Door frame repair services involve assessing and fixing issues that affect the structural integrity and appearance of a door’s frame. Over time, door frames can become damaged due to everyday wear and tear, moisture exposure, or accidental impacts. Repair work may include replacing rotted or cracked wood, straightening bent frames, filling gaps, or reinforcing weak points to ensure the door functions properly and looks presentable. Skilled contractors focus on restoring the frame’s stability so that doors open and close smoothly, while also preventing further damage that could compromise security or insulation.

Many common problems lead homeowners to seek door frame repairs. These include doors that stick or don’t latch properly, which can be caused by shifting or warping of the frame. Cracks, gaps, or rotting wood may develop from moisture infiltration or age, reducing the door’s effectiveness in providing security or insulation. Additionally, physical impacts from accidents or forced entry attempts can damage the frame’s structure. Addressing these issues promptly helps maintain the safety of the property, improves energy efficiency, and enhances curb appeal.

The overview below groups typical Door Frame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Marshfield, MA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or door frame repairs in Marshfield range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es, such as patching or re-nailing,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um, which is usually for more involved minor repairs.

Moderate Fixes - More extensive repairs, like replacing sections of the door frame or fixing significant rot, generally cost between $600-$1,200.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this range, while larger jobs may approach $2,000.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ire door frame typically costs between $1,200-$3,000 depending on size, materials, and complexity. Many full replacements fall into the middle of this range, with larger, more complex projects reaching higher prices.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ger or custom door frame repairs, such as structural modifications or historic restorations, can exceed $3,000 and may reach $5,000+ in some cases. These projects are less common and usually involve specialized craftsmanship or mater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What signs indicate a door frame needs repair? Common signs include misaligned doors, difficulty closing or opening, or visible cracks and damage in the frame.

Can damaged door frames affect the security of my home? Yes, compromised door frames can weaken the overall security and make it easier for intruders to gain access.

What types of door frame repairs do local contractors typically handle? They often address issues like realigning frames, replacing damaged sections, and fixing or replacing hardware.

Is it possible to repair a door frame without replacing the entire unit? Many repairs can be done by fixing or reinforcing specific areas, avoiding the need for full replacement.
